Research showing that activation of negative stereotypes can impair the performance of stigmatized individuals on a wide variety of tasks has proliferated. However, a complete understanding of the processes underlying these stereotype threat effects on behavior is still lacking. The authors examine stereotype threat in the context of research on stress arousal, vigilance, working memory, and selfregulation to develop a process model of how negative stereotypes impair performance on cognitive and social tasks that require controlled processing, as well as sensorimotor tasks that require automatic processing. The authors argue that stereotype threat disrupts performance via 3 distinct, yet interrelated, mechanisms: (a) a physiological stress response that directly impairs prefrontal processing, (b) a tendency to actively monitor performance, and (c) efforts to suppress negative thoughts and emotions in the service of self-regulation. These mechanisms combine to consume executive resources needed to perform well on cognitive and social tasks. The active monitoring mechanism disrupts performance on sensorimotor tasks directly. Empirical evidence for these assertions is reviewed, and implications for interventions designed to alleviate stereotype threat are discussed.

Stereotype threat (ST) occurs when the awareness of a negative stereotype about a social group in a particular domain produces suboptimal performance by members of that group. Although ST has been repeatedly demonstrated, far less is known about how its effects are realized. Using mathematical problem solving as a test bed, the authors demonstrate in 5 experiments that ST harms math problems that rely heavily on working memory resources—especially phonological aspects of this system. Moreover, by capitalizing on an understanding of the cognitive mechanisms by which ST exerts its impact, the authors show (a) how ST can be alleviated (e.g., by heavily practicing once-susceptible math problems such that they are retrieved directly from long-term memory rather than computed via a working-memory-intensive algorithm) and (b) when it will spill over onto subsequent tasks unrelated to the stereotype in question but dependent on the same cognitive resources that stereotype threat also uses. The current work extends the knowledge of the causal mechanisms of stereotype threat and demonstrates how its effects can be attenuated and propagated.

On the basis of a review of the extant literature describing emotion–cognition interactions, the authors propose 4 methodological desiderata for studying how task-irrelevant affect modulates cognition and present data from an experiment satisfying them. Consistent with accounts of the hemispheric asymme-tries characterizing withdrawal-related negative affect and visuospatial working memory (WM) in prefrontal and parietal cortices, threat-induced anxiety selectively disrupted accuracy of spatial but not verbal WM performance. Furthermore, individual differences in physiological measures of anxiety statistically mediated the degree of disruption. A second experiment revealed that individuals charac-terized by high levels of behavioral inhibition exhibited more intense anxiety and relatively worse spatial WM performance in the absence of threat, solidifying the authors ’ inference that anxiety causally mediates disruption. These observations suggest a revision of extant models of how anxiety sculpts cognition and underscore the utility of the desiderata.

Self-regulation is a core aspect of adaptive human behavior that has been studied, largely in parallel, through the lenses of social and personality psychology as well as cognitive psychology. Here, we argue for more communication between these disciplines and highlight recent research that speaks to their connection. We outline how basic facets of executive functioning (working memory operations, behavioral inhibition, and taskswitching) may subserve successful self-regulation. We also argue that temporary reductions in executive functions underlie many of the situational risk factors identified in the social psychological research on selfregulation and review recent evidence that the training of executive functions holds significant potential for improving poor self-regulation in problem populations.

Research documents performance decrements resulting from the activation of a negative task-relevant stereotype. We combine a number of strands of work to identify causes of stereotype threat in a way that allows us to reverse the effects and improve the performance of individuals with negative task-relevant stereotypes. We draw on prior work suggesting that negative stereotypes induce a prevention focus, and other research suggesting that people exhibit greater flexibility when their regulatory focus matches the reward structure of the task. This work suggests that stereotype threat effects emerge from a prevention focus combined with tasks that have an explicit or implicit gains reward structure. We find flexible performance can be induced in individuals who have a negative task-relevant stereotype by using a losses reward structure. We demonstrate the interaction of stereotypes and the reward structure of the task using chronic stereotypes and GRE math problems (Experiment 1), and primed stereotypes and a category learning task (Experiments 2a and 2b). We discuss implications of this research for other work on stereotype threat.

Novice and skilled golfers took a series of golf putts with a standard putter (Exp. 1) or a distorted funny putter (consisting of an s-shaped and arbitrarily weighted putter shaft; Exp. 2) under instructions to either (a) take as much time as needed to be accurate or to (b) putt as fast as possible while still being accurate. Planning and movement time were measured for each putt. In both experiments, novices produced the typical speed–accuracy trade-off. Going slower, in terms of both the planning and movement components of execution, improved performance. In contrast, skilled golfers benefited from reduced performance time when using the standard putter in Exp. 1 and, specifically, taking less time to plan improved performance. In Exp. 2, skilled golfers improved by going slower when using the funny putter, but only when it was unfamiliar. Thus, skilled performance benefits from speed instructions when wielding highly familiar tools (i.e., the standard putter) is harmed when using new tools (i.e., the funny putter), and benefits again by speed instructions as the new tool becomes familiar. Planning time absorbs these changes.

Studies into the effects of stereotype threat (ST) on test performance have shed new light on race and sex differences in achievement and intelligence test scores. In this article, the authors relate ST theory to the psychometric concept of measurement invariance and show that ST effects may be viewed as a source of measurement bias. As such, ST effects are detectable by means of multigroup confirmatory factor analysis. This enables research into the generalizability of ST effects to real-life or high-stakes testing. The modeling approach is described in detail and applied to 3 experiments in which the amount of ST for minorities and women was manipulated. Results indicate that ST results in measurement bias of intelligence and mathematics tests.

Past research finds that males outperform females in competitive situations. Using data from multiple-round math tournaments, we verify this finding during the initial round of competition. The performance gap between males and females, however, dis-appears after the first round. In later rounds, only math ability (not gender) serves as a significant predictor of performance. Several possible explanations are discussed. The results suggest that we should be cautious about using data from one-round ex-periments to generalize about behavior. (JEL J16, C93)

Abstract: Complex cognitive processes like concept learning involve a mixture of redundant explicit and implicit processes that are active simultaneously. This aspect of cognitive architecture creates difficulties in determining the influence of consciousness on processing. We propose that the interaction between an individual’s regulatory focus and the reward structure of the current task influences the degree to which explicit processing is active. Thus, by manipulating people’s motivational state and the nature of the task they perform, we can vary the influence of conscious processing in cognitive performance. We demonstrate the utility of this view by focusing on studies in which people acquire new perceptual concepts by learning to classify them. This technique will allow us to better tease apart the roles of explicit and implicit processing in a variety of cognitive tasks.
